Output 8d3305e77292962dfda61700252715736b143eb20d9232645401ccabf9653458:1

value
74103755
script pubkey
OP_0 OP_PUSHBYTES_32 66c4adfb5053389932de6059409271f715f0e62e412a53255b7f65022139f9f4
address
bc1qvmz2m76s2vufjvk7vpv5pyn37u2lpe3wgy49xf2m0ajsygfel86qzc9qpj
transaction
8d3305e77292962dfda61700252715736b143eb20d9232645401ccabf9653458
spent
true